            • #7
              Re: oh no!!

              a compression test will usually tell you when a headgasket is bad

              usually all of the cylinders will be within spec, and you will have one thats drastically low

              if you do have a low one, put some oil in the cylinder, and do another compression check, if the compression INCREASES you know the rings for that cylinder are good, and you either have a headgasket problem, or bad valves (which i would say it is a headgasket in your case)

                  • #10
                    Re: oh no!!

                    Originally posted by cam98aro View Post
                    a compression test will usually tell you when a headgasket is bad

                    usually all of the cylinders will be within spec, and you will have one thats drastically low
                    rule of thumb is the lowest cyl should not be below 10% of the highest. if you have 190 psi of compression on the highest, then your lowest should not be below 171 psi.
